Marco Begaye was born in Ganado, Arizona. He grew up on the Navajo reservation with his family of silversmiths. Marco is the son of Jimmy Begaye; and brother of Vernon Begaye, who is also recognized for his excellent craftsmanship.

Marco blends the traditional along with the contemporary styles. He is known for beautiful stones and fine silver work. His superb craftsmanship, attention to detail, and attractive designs have earned him recognition with numerous awards for his jewelry over the years.

His work has been featured in magazines, and in the book “Navajo Indian Jewelry” by Jerry and Lois Jacka.
